Temporary Supportive Housing is a New Construction project located at 3031 El Camino Street, Houston, TX 77054 in Houston, Texas. The project has an estimated value of $22.4M covering 112,000 sq ft. Houston Area Women's Center is the property owner and GSMA, Inc. is the design firm of record. The project was registered with TDLR on September 21, 2021.

๐Scope of Work
A 4 story mixed use building with offices, client services, and resident services all on the first floor. The upper 3 floors contain 135 sleeping units including 45 efficiency apartments and 90 one bedroom apartments.
Note: This project is registered under the Texas Accessibility Standards (TAS) program. TDLR registration is required for commercial and public facility construction to ensure compliance with accessibility requirements under Texas Government Code Chapter 469.
